    A lifelong learner, heterodox thinker, and self-taught dabbler in many disciplines, Michael D. C. Bowen brings a wealth of wisdom on the many worlds he has traveled through. After building his career in data engineering and raising his family, he decided to undertake a “martial education” by joining the citizens’ police academy and being trained as a first-responder. What have his life experiences taught him about the process of becoming a fully self-actualized human being?


    Michael David Cobb Bowen is a writer, data engineer, and entrepreneur. He helped found Free Black Thought, Rights Universal, and the Conservative Brotherhood. Bowen considers himself a wry Stoic and tactical epistemologist. He has been published in Newsweek and was a regular NPR contributor as well as a host at Cafe Utne. His online writing projects on political, cultural and philosophical subjects reach back over 23 years. His latest project, Stoic Observations, focuses on matters of knowledge & power, global frameworks, information theory, and the practical aspects of moving from philosophy to philosophy. His mission is to document the journey of finding the true value of Western Civilization through Socratic dialogue.

    In this episode of the Dive Podcast, we interview freelance writer Anthony Effinger about his article concerning ivermectin. Ivermectin is commonly used as an animal de-worming medication but Portland-based podcasters Bret Weinstein and Heather Heying have been preaching its effects against COVID-19. It has now become a favorite medicine among the anti-vaxxers despite experts warning of its effects. We digest this story and more on E38 of our show.

    Nick talks to evolutionary biologists Bret Weinstein & Heather Heying about using evolutionary thinking to understand humanity's predicaments in the 21st century. They discuss a variety of topics related to their new book, "A Hunter Gatherers Guide to the 21st Century," including modern medicine, dieting & health, sleep & light, dating & mating systems, and questions related to consciousness and the state of civilization at large. The book is meant to provide an evolutionary toolkit for understanding the modern human condition by understanding our past.
